Professional Career Milestones

• Transgenic Sciences: Developed the first transgenic mouse Alzheimer's model

• Pfizer Global R&D: Started the Pharmacogenomics group in 1996!

• Helicos BioSciences: CSO - World’s first single molecule DNA sequencing

• Pfizer Boston Center for Therapeutic Innovation: A new model for drug discovery and development

• Claritas Genomics: Pediatric Molecular Diagnostics, company’s founding CEO

• Medley Genomics: Data analytics in oncology, CEO and Co-founder

Transitioning Helicos to Dx Laboratory

Approach• Helicos IPO in 2007 – Raised ~$55M• Two Additional Funding Rounds • Several NIH Grants >$5M • By 2011 – Competition in NGS, Attempted Pivot to Dx NewCo.• Developed Business Strategy/Model/Revenue Projections• Discussions with ~25 Venture Capital Firms

The Opportunity

• Newco to launch unique sequencing-based Molecular Diagnostic (MDx) test menu through ConVerge’s CLIA lab

• Helicos: only single-step, targeted single molecule sequencing platform in the world– Freedom-to-Operate in the MDx space

• First product: BRCA1/2 Sequencing Test – Highly profitable genetic test (90% gross margin) - Market estimated at $875M– Launch – within one year

• ConVerge: CLIA licensed, CAP accredited, excellent “Women’s Health Services” – CEO, COO, VP Sales and IT Director each >20 years experience in laboratory services

industry• National Distribution Strategy

– ConVerge in New England as regional prototype for national coverage– COE direct relationship with LiberateDx

• National Distributor Network Platform for distribution of additional tests both developed internally and by others

Current Market for Myriad Genetics BRACAnalysis™

• Market potential = $875M• Current Revenue from BRACAnalysis = $360M

annualized – with gross margins of 90%– 70% from oncologists/Cancer Centers (50% penetrated)– 30% from OB/GYNs (15% penetrated)

• Pricing– List Price $3,120 (does not include $700 BART test)– ASP ~$2,870

SourcesJ.P.Morgan North American Equity Research, Medical and Life Science Technology Myriad Coverage Initiation Report – 26 April 2010MYGN Form 10-K for the quarterly period ended December 31, 2010 13

Capital Requirements

Year 1 - BRCA Assay Validation $5,000,000

Year 2 - Commercial Launch/Working Capital $5,000,000

Other Provision/Contingency $5,000,000

Total Estimated Capital Funding Requirement $15,000,000

• Summer, 2011 --Unable to raise funds due to uncertainty around Myriad Patent

• June 13, 2013 -- The Supreme Court ruled today that isolated human genes cannot be patented, a partial defeat for Myriad Genetics, a company that had been awarded patents on the so-called BRCA1 and BRCA2 genes in the 1990s.

CLARITAS GENOMICS

The Need is Great: Together We Make a Difference

17

1 NIH, 2CDC, 3Shire, 2013 Rare Disease Impact Report: Insights from patients and the medical community*Rare Disease Defined: Patient population estimated at fewer than 200,000 in the U.S.

By The Numbers1:•>7,400 rare diseases•80% are genetic•50% are pediatric in presentation•25—30M people live with rare disease* (US)•250—300M people live with rare disease (Ex-US)

Studies2,3 Have Found:•7—12 years to diagnosis•8 specialty physicians •2 to 3 misdiagnoses•Physicians don't have the time or information •Major emotional toll on patients and caregivers

Applications for Drug Discovery and Development

• Combination Therapy: Clonal vs. Subclonal, ID Rare Drivers

• Tumor Response/Resistance/Relapse: Longitudinal Data

• Oncology Vaccine Designs: Neoepitope Optimization

• Immuno-therapy Response: Clonality of Neoepitopes

• PDx Mouse Models: Efficacy/Resistance

• Novel Disease Pathways: Reveal Gene Networks

• Patient Stratification: Mutually Exclusive Mutation Patterns
